1.Application of technetium galactosyl human serum albumin diethylenetriamine pentaacetic acid injection on liver imaging in mouse models with different hepatic injuries.
Yi-lei MAO ; Yi-nü DONG ; Xian-zhong ZHANG ; Wen-jiang YANG ; Shun-da DU ; Jun-xiang TONG ; Xue-bin WANG
Acta Academiae Medicinae Sinicae 2008;30(4):404-408
OBJECTIVETo identify the uptake and biological distribution of technetium galactosyl human serum albumin diethylenetriamine pentaacetic acid injection (99mTc-GSA) in three mouse models with different degrees of hepatic injuries.
METHODSThree mouse models including hepatic fibrosis, hepatic cholestasis, and liver cancer were established. Hepatic fibrosis model was established by intraperitoneal injection of carbon tetrachloride, 0.4 ml 10%, every 48 hours for 48 days. Hepatic cholestasis model was set up by ligature of the common bile duct for 72 hours, and liver cancer model by implantation of H22 tumor cells underneath liver capsule for 10 days. On measurement, each mouse in different models and normal controls was injected with 0.1 ml (0.37 MBq)99mTc-GSA (2 microg) into vena caudalis, and 5 minutes later sacrificed by decapitation. Important organs and tissues including liver, heart, lungs, kidney, spleen, stomach, blood, bones, muscles, and intestines were taken and their different radio countings were measured. The hepatic injuries were evaluated with serum and pathological examinations.
RESULTS99mTc-GSA was concentrated in the liver in all three models and the control mice ( >40% ID x g(-1)). Compared with the control mice (90.05 +/- 10.55)% ID x g(-1), the density of 99mTc-GSA was significantly lower in the models with hepatic injuries (P < 0.001). The liver function test indicated that the injury in hepatic fibrosis model was less serious than those in the other two models. However, the concentration of 99mTc-GSA in hepatic fibrosis model [(72.20 +/- 2.13)% ID x g(-1)] was significantly higher than those in the models with cholestasis [(56.72 +/- 5.92)% ID x g(-1)] and liver cancer [(42.80 +/- 6.05)% ID x g(-1)] (P < 0.001).
CONCLUSIONS99mTc-GSA may well concentrate in liver and its concentration degree is adversely correlated with hepatic injuries. Therefore 99mTc-GSA may be clinically used as liver imaging agent. When combined with three-dimensional scanning technique, it may facilitate constructing a new three-dimensional imaging method to demonstrate the function of designed liver segments.

2.Study on in vitro release and percutaneous absorption for Zhitong cataplasm.
Li-Hua SONG ; Mao-Bo DU ; Shu-Zhi LIU ; Ke-Ya GE ; Wen-Ping WANG ; Qi-Chen CAO ; Xian-Duan LI
China Journal of Chinese Materia Medica 2013;38(14):2306-2308
To evaluate in vitro release and transdermal behaviors of Zhitong cataplasm, modified Franz diffusion cell method was applied to investigate in vitro transdermal absorption of Zhitong cataplasm and the content of tetrahydropalmatine was determined by HPLC. In 24 hours, accumulative release rate of tetrahydropalmatine was 81. 9%, transmission rate was 2.26 microg x cm(-2) x h(-1). In 48 hours, accumulative transdermal rate and transmission rate of tetrahydropalmatine were 20.31%, 0.22 pg x cm(-2) x h(-1). So Zhitong cataplasm had a good release and transdermal properties and transdermal actions were consistent with zero-order kinetics process.

3.Clinical value of whole-body magnetic resonance diffusion weighted imaging on detection of malignant metastases.
Cheng LI ; Zhen-sheng LIU ; Xian-mao DU ; Ling HE ; Jian CHEN ; Wei WANG ; Fei SUN ; Fang DU ; Zhi-gang LUO ; Zhen-long XUE ; Yi ZHAO ; Chang-wu ZHOU
Chinese Medical Sciences Journal 2009;24(2):112-116
OBJECTIVETo evaluate the value of whole-body diffusion weighted imaging (WB-DWI) on detection of malignant metastasis.
METHODSForty-six patients with malignant tumors underwent WB-DWI examinations between April 2007 and August 2007 in our hospital. Before WB-DWI examination, the primary cancers of all the patients were confirmed by pathology, and the TNM-stage was assessed with conventional magnetic resonance imaging (MRI) or computed tomography (CT). WB-DWI was performed using short TI inversion recovery echo-planar imaging (STIR-EPI) sequence. Abnormal high signal intensities on WB-DWI were considered as metastases. The results of WB-DWI were compared with other imaging modalities. For the assessment of the diagnostic capability of WB-DWI, WB-DWI were compared with CT for demonstrating mediastinal lymph node metastases and lung metastases, and with conventional MRI for demonstrating metastases in other locations.
RESULTSWB-DWI demonstrated 143 focuses, 14 of which were diagnosed to be benign lesions in routine imaging. The number of bone metastases depicted on WB-DWI and routine imaging was 85 and 86; lymph node metastases was 17 and 18; liver metastases was 14 and 14; lung metastases was 4 and 8; and brain metastases was 6 and 8, respectively. WB-DWI failed to detect 12 metastatic lesions including 3 osteoplastic bone metastases, 4 lung metastases, 3 mediastinal lymph node metastases, and 2 brain metastases. Four metastatic lesions including 2 deltopectoral lymph nodes and 2 rib metastases were detected with WB-DWI alone, all of which evolved greatly during clinical follow-up for more than 6 months. WB-DWI had higher detection rates for metastatic lesions in liver, bone, and lymph nodes than those in lung and brain (chi2=30, P<0.001).
CONCLUSIONSWB-DWI could detect most of metastatic lesions that were diagnosed with conventional MRI and CT. The limitations of WB-DWI might be had high false-positive rate and low efficiency in detecting mediastinal lymph node, brain, and lung metastases.

5.Early recurrence after the resection of hepatocellular carcinoma.
Xin LU ; Hai-tao ZHAO ; Yi-lei MAO ; Xin-ting SANG ; Yi-yao XU ; Shun-da DU ; Hai-feng XU ; Tian-yi CHI ; Zhi-ying YANG ; Shou-xian ZHONG ; Jie-fu HUANG
Acta Academiae Medicinae Sinicae 2008;30(4):415-420
OBJECTIVETo observe the precise time of the recurrence after resection of hepatocellular carcinoma (HCC) and to further explore the risk factors associated with postoperative recurrence.
METHODSTotally 94 patients who had undergone resection of HCC were divided into three groups based on the time of recurrence, which was indicated by the digital subtraction angiography (DSA) examination: recurrence between 1 to 6 months, recurrence between 7 to 12 months, and tumor-free after 12 months. Patients with intra-hepatic recurrence were treated with transcatheter arterial chemoembolization and confirmed by CT scans after embolization, contrast-enhanced ultrasound, or magnetic resonance imaging.
RESULTSThe recurrence rates of 6 months and 1 year were 30.9% and 36.2%, respectively. No statistically significant difference between 6-month and 1-year recurrence rates was observed. Nine (26.5%) patients with recurrence and five (8.3%) patients free of tumor had previously presented as multifocal HCC, which showed a statistical significance (P = 0.032). The diagnostic accuracy of DSA was 87.2%, which was eventually confirmed by the other investigations.
CONCLUSIONSMost recurrences occure within the first six months postoperatively and multifocal carcinogenesis is one of the risk factors associated with early recurrence after liver resection for advanced HCC. DSA is an important surveillance for early detection of intra-hepatic recurrence after surgery; meanwhile, it also provides information for early management to control the disease progression and for future active therapies.

6.Preoperative evaluation of liver function using 99mTc-diethyl iminodiacetic acid based on single photon emission computed tomography.
Shun-da DU ; Yi-lei MAO ; Fang LI ; Meng OUYANG ; Jun-xiang TONG ; Xin-ting SANG ; Zhi-ying YANG ; Xin LU ; Tian-yi CHI ; Hai-tao ZHAO ; Yi-yao XU ; Hai-feng XU ; Shou-xian ZHONG ; Jie-fu HUANG
Acta Academiae Medicinae Sinicae 2008;30(4):409-414
OBJECTIVETo establish a three-dimentional liver function evaluation system using 99mTc-diethyl iminodiacetic acid (99mTc-EHIDA) scintigraphy based on single photon emission computed tomography (SPECT).
METHODSTotally 16 patients with liver lesions were divided into cirrhosis group and non-cirrhosis group. SPECT was performed 2 days before operation and 5 days after operation. Serum liver functions were examined on the same day of scintigraphy. SPECT images of areas of interest of heart and liver were aquired. Time of the peak of EHIDA density in liver (Tpeak), five-minutes heart liver index (HLI5), blood clearance index (HH15), receptor index (LHL15), and the predictive values were calculated.
RESULTSTpeak was not significantly different between two groups, while HLI5, HH15, and LHL15 were significantly different (P = 0.033, P = 0.001, and P = 0.005). HLI, and LHL15 were significantly correlated with preoperative total protein and prealbumin levels (P = 0.003, P = 0.015, P = 0.022, P = 0.038) and post-operative prealbumin (P = 0.037, P = 0.042). The predictive values of HLI5 and LHL15 correlated well with postoperative HLI5 and LHL15 (r = 0.675, P = 0.016; r = 0.629, P = 0.028).
CONCLUSIONThe three-dimentional liver function evaluation system using 99mTc-EHIDA based on liver SPECT may facilitate the further studies of risks of liver surgery.

7.Clinical experiences of surgical manipulations for hepatic masses in difficult sites.
Xin-ting SANG ; Xin LU ; Yi-lei MAO ; Hai-tao ZHAO ; Yi-yao XU ; Shun-da DU ; Hai-feng XU ; Tian-yi CHI ; Zhi-ying YANG ; Shou-xian ZHONG ; Jie-fu HUANG
Acta Academiae Medicinae Sinicae 2008;30(4):400-403
OBJECTIVETo summarize the surgical experiences, risks, complications, and managements for hepatic masses in difficult sites.
METHODSTotally 47 patients were divided into three groups based on the liver tumor sites: primary porta hepatis group, secondary porta hepatis group, and caudate lobe group. All patients underwent different portion of hepatectomy.
RESULTSThe surgery duration was (289.6 +/- 62.2) ml-nutes, intra-operative blood loss was (602.3 +/- 256.4) ml, and intra-operative blood transfusion was (524.0 +/- 325.9) ml. Incidence of surgical complications in each group was 61.5%, 26.9%, and 25%, respectively. Serious complications observed were biliary leakage (27.7%), bleeding (6.4%), and post-operative liver failure (2.1%). Three perioperative deaths were reported: two patients died of bleeding, and one patient died from liver failure.
CONCLUSIONSDissection of the liver and exposure of major blood vessels and biliary ducts are of critical importance in the surgeries for hepatic masses in difficult sites, and post-operative complications may be remarkably reduced through delicate manipulations of the small intra-hepatic vessels and biliary ducts during resection. A thorough pre-operative evaluation plays a key role in predicting the feasibility and risks of the surgery. Damage to the major blood vessels adjacent to the tumor, in addition to bleeding, may result in in-flow or outflow obstruction and cause necrosis of the corresponding hepatic lobe. Compared with damage to the primary portal area, vascular damage to the secondary porta is generally associated with higher fatality.

8.Analysis of cardiovascular disease-related NF-κB-regulated genes and microRNAs in TNFα-treated primary mouse vascular endothelial cells.
Hui ZHU ; Yun LI ; Mao-Xian WANG ; Ju-Hong WANG ; Wen-Xin DU ; Fei ZHOU
Journal of Zhejiang University. Science. B 2019;20(10):803-815
Activated nuclear factor-κB (NF-κB) plays an important role in the development of cardiovascular disease (CVD) through its regulated genes and microRNAs (miRNAs). However, the gene regulation profile remains unclear. In this study, primary mouse vascular endothelial cells (pMVECs) were employed to detect CVD-related NF-κB-regulated genes and miRNAs. Genechip assay identified 77 NF-κB-regulated genes, including 45 upregulated and 32 downregulated genes, in tumor necrosis factor α (TNFα)-treated pMVECs. Ten of these genes were also found to be regulated by NF-κB in TNFα-treated HeLa cells. Quantitative real-time PCR (qRT-PCR) assay confirmed the up-regulation of Egr1, Tnf, and Btg2 by NF-κB in the TNFα-treated pMVECs. The functional annotation revealed that many NF-κB-regulated genes identified in pMVECs were clustered into classical NF-κB-involved biological processes. Genechip assay also identified 26 NF-κB-regulated miRNAs, of which 21 were upregulated and 5 downregulated, in the TNFα-treated pMVECs. Further analysis showed that nine of the identified genes are regulated by seven of these miRNAs. Finally, among the identified NF-κB-regulated genes and miRNAs, 5 genes and 12 miRNAs were associated with CVD by miRWalk and genetic association database analysis. Taken together, these findings show an intricate gene regulation network raised by NF-κB in TNFα-treated pMVECs. The network provides new insights for understanding the molecular mechanism underlying the progression of CVD.

9.Medical expenditure for esophageal cancer in China: a 10-year multicenter retrospective survey (2002–2011)
Guo LAN-WEI ; Huang HUI-YAO ; Shi JU-FANG ; Lv LI-HONG ; Bai YA-NA ; Mao A-YAN ; Liao XIAN-ZHEN ; Liu GUO-XIANG ; Ren JIAN-SONG ; Sun XIAO-JIE ; Zhu XIN-YU ; Zhou JIN-YI ; Gong JI-YONG ; Zhou QI ; Zhu LIN ; Liu YU-QIN ; Song BING-BING ; Du LING-BIN ; Xing XIAO-JING ; Lou PEI-AN ; Sun XIAO-HUA ; Qi XIAO ; Wu SHOU-LING ; Cao RONG ; Lan LI ; Ren YING ; Zhang KAI ; He JIE ; Zhang JIAN-GONG ; Dai MIN
Chinese Journal of Cancer 2017;36(11):548-559
Background: Esophageal cancer is associated with substantial disease burden in China, and data on the economic burden are fundamental for setting priorities in cancer interventions. The medical expenditure for the diagnosis and treatment of esophageal cancer in China has not been fully quantified. This study aimed to examine the medical expenditure of Chinese patients with esophageal cancer and the associated trends. Methods: From 2012 to 2014, a hospital-based multicenter retrospective survey was conducted in 37 hospitals in 13 provinces/municipalities across China as a part of the Cancer Screening Program of Urban China. For each esophageal cancer patient diagnosed between 2002 and 2011, clinical information and expense data were extracted by using structured questionnaires. All expense data were reported in Chinese Yuan (CNY; 1 CNY= 0.155 USD) based on the 2011 value and inflated using the year-specific health care consumer price index for China. Results: A total of 14,967 esophageal cancer patients were included in the analysis. It was estimated that the overall average expenditure per patient was 38,666 CNY, and an average annual increase of 6.27% was observed from 2002 (25,111 CNY) to 2011 (46,124 CNY). The average expenditures were 34,460 CNY for stage Ⅰ, 39,302 CNY for stage Ⅱ, 40,353 CNY for stage Ⅲ, and 37,432 CNY for stage IV diseases (P < 0.01). The expenditure also differed by the therapy type, which was 38,492 CNY for surgery, 27,933 CNY for radiotherapy, and 27,805 CNY for chemotherapy (P < 0.05). Drugs contributed to 45.02% of the overall expenditure. Conclusions: These conservative estimates suggested that medical expenditures for esophageal cancer in China substantially increased in the last 10 years, treatment for early-stage esophageal cancer costs less than that for advanced cases, and spending on drugs continued to account for a considerable proportion of the overall expenditure.
10.Observation of acupoint application of gel plaster on insomnia.
Tuo-Ran WANG ; Ying HAN ; Bing LIU ; Mao-Bo DU ; Yan-Hua XIANG ; Xiao-Hui DU ; Zhe-Xian LI ; Yue JIAO
Chinese Acupuncture & Moxibustion 2021;41(5):505-509
OBJECTIVE:
To observe the effect of acupoint application of gel plaster on quality of sleep and life in patients with insomnia.
METHODS:
A total of 63 patients with insomnia were randomized into a gel plaster group (32 cases, 1 case dropped off) and a placebo plaster group (31 cases). Acupoint application of gel plaster was applied at Yintang (GV 29) and Yongquan (KI 1) in the gel plaster group, placebo plaster was applied at the same acupoints in the placebo plaster group. The treatment was given from bedtime to early moming of the next day, 5 days were as one course, with 2-day interval, totally 4 courses were required in the both groups. Pittsburgh sleep quality index (PSQI), Epworth sleepiness scale (ESS) and Flinders fatigue scale were used to evaluate the sleep quality and fatigue level of the patients in the both groups before and after treatment and at 2 weeks of follow-up. The variations of insomnia TCM syndrome score and the 36-item short-form health survey (SF-36) score before and after treatment were observed.
